Understanding Energy Efficiency in Ceiling Fans
What Makes a Ceiling Fan Energy Efficient?
Energy efficiency in ceiling fans boils down to how much air movement you get per watt of electricity consumed. The most efficient models can move over 6,000 cubic feet of air per minute while using less energy than a standard 60-watt light bulb. This performance metric, known as airflow efficiency, is the gold standard for comparing models. Look for fans that deliver high CFM (cubic feet per minute) ratings alongside low wattage consumption. The magic happens through precision engineering—every component from motor design to blade angle plays a role in maximizing airflow while minimizing electrical draw.
The Role of Motor Technology
The motor is the heart of any ceiling fan’s efficiency story. Traditional AC motors, while reliable, typically consume 60-100 watts on high speed. Modern DC motors represent a quantum leap forward, often using just 15-35 watts for comparable or superior airflow. These brushless motors generate less heat, operate nearly silently, and offer more speed settings for fine-tuned comfort. The permanent magnet technology in DC motors eliminates energy waste through friction and heat generation, converting nearly all electricity into pure rotational force. This isn’t just about lower utility bills—DC motors also extend the fan’s lifespan by reducing wear and tear on internal components.
Decoding CFM and Wattage Ratings
When shopping, you’ll encounter two critical numbers: CFM and wattage. CFM tells you how much air the fan moves, while wattage reveals its power consumption. The sweet spot is a high CFM-to-watt ratio. A fan moving 7,000 CFM while using 30 watts delivers 233 CFM per watt—exceptional efficiency. Compare that to older models that might move 4,000 CFM while gulping 80 watts (only 50 CFM per watt). Energy Star certification requires minimum efficiency standards, but the best performers far exceed these baselines. Always check these ratings on product specifications rather than trusting marketing claims alone.
Key Features That Maximize Efficiency
Blade Design and Aerodynamics
Blade geometry dramatically impacts performance. The most efficient fans feature blades with optimized pitch angles—typically between 12 and 15 degrees—that capture and move air without creating drag. Blade shape matters too; aerodynamic profiles with tapered edges reduce turbulence and noise while maximizing airflow. Contrary to popular belief, more blades don’t necessarily mean better performance. Three to five well-designed blades often outperform seven or more poorly shaped ones. The key is balance: each blade should complement the others to create a smooth, powerful vortex rather than chaotic air movement.
Optimal Blade Span for Your Space
Size matters, but bigger isn’t always better. A fan that’s too large for a room can create uncomfortable drafts and waste energy, while an undersized fan will strain to move adequate air. For rooms up to 75 square feet, a 29-36 inch span works perfectly. Medium rooms of 76-144 square feet need 36-42 inches. Larger spaces of 144-225 square feet require 44-50 inches, and great rooms over 225 square feet benefit from spans of 50-72 inches or multiple fans. The goal is consistent air circulation throughout the entire space without creating a wind tunnel effect in one corner.
Material Matters: Durability and Performance
Blade material affects both efficiency and longevity. High-quality ABS plastic, wood composites, or aircraft-grade aluminum offer the best combination of light weight and stiffness. Heavy materials require more energy to rotate, while flimsy materials flex and create inefficiency. Moisture-resistant materials are crucial for outdoor installations to prevent warping that throws off balance. The weight-to-strength ratio directly impacts motor strain—lighter blades mean the motor works less, uses less power, and lasts longer. Premium materials also maintain their precise shape over time, ensuring consistent performance year after year.
Smart Controls and Automation
Modern efficiency extends beyond the motor. Integrated smart controls allow you to program operation based on occupancy, time of day, or temperature sensors. Timers ensure fans don’t run in empty rooms, while smartphone apps let you adjust settings without leaving your seat. Some advanced systems sync with your thermostat, automatically adjusting fan speed as room temperature changes. Motion sensors can trigger operation when someone enters and shut down after departure, eliminating wasted energy from forgotten fans left running. These features transform a simple appliance into an intelligent climate management tool.
Sizing Your Fan for Maximum Impact
Room Size Guidelines
Proper sizing prevents energy waste and ensures comfort. Measure your room’s square footage by multiplying length by width. For irregular spaces, break them into rectangles and add the areas together. A 10x12 foot bedroom (120 sq ft) needs a 42-48 inch fan, while a 20x20 foot living room (400 sq ft) requires either a 60-72 inch fan or two 52-inch fans positioned strategically. In long, narrow rooms, two smaller fans often outperform one large fan, creating more even air distribution and allowing you to run each at lower, more efficient speeds.
Ceiling Height Considerations
Installation height critically affects performance and safety. Fans should hang 8-9 feet above the floor for optimal airflow. Standard 8-foot ceilings need hugger or flush-mount fans that sit tight to the ceiling. For 9-foot ceilings, a 6-inch downrod positions the fan perfectly. Ceilings 10 feet or higher require downrods that place the fan within the ideal height range—add 6 inches of downrod for each additional foot of ceiling height. Too low and the fan creates a narrow column of air; too high and it struggles to circulate air effectively at occupant level.
Outdoor vs. Indoor Applications
Outdoor fans face unique challenges that affect efficiency. Damp-rated fans work for covered porches where moisture is occasional, while wet-rated fans withstand direct rain and snow. Outdoor models need sealed motors to prevent corrosion and bearings protected from dust and salt air. These protective features add weight and can slightly reduce efficiency, but the alternative is premature failure. For covered outdoor spaces, look for models specifically engineered for outdoor use that maintain high CFM ratings despite the extra protection. The investment pays off through longevity and consistent performance in harsh conditions.
Installation Strategies for Peak Performance
Proper Mounting Techniques
Installation quality directly impacts efficiency. A wobbly fan wastes energy through vibration and operates noisily. Always mount to a ceiling-rated electrical box secured to a joist, not just drywall. Use the included stability bracket or a fan-rated box that can support the full weight plus dynamic loads. Ensure the mounting ball or canopy sits level—even a slight tilt forces the motor to work harder. For cathedral ceilings, use an angled mounting kit that keeps the fan perfectly vertical. Proper mounting reduces motor strain, extends component life, and ensures smooth, efficient operation.
Electrical Requirements and Safety
Most modern efficient fans work with standard 15-amp circuits, but multiple fans on one circuit require load calculations. A dedicated circuit prevents interference from other appliances and ensures consistent voltage. Always turn off power at the breaker, not just the wall switch, before installation. Use wire connectors rated for the gauge and number of wires, and tuck them neatly into the box to prevent vibration-related failures. If you’re adding a fan where no fixture existed, hire an electrician to run proper wiring—extension cords or plug-in adapters create fire hazards and void warranties.
Balancing and Maintenance Essentials
An unbalanced fan consumes up to 20% more energy and wears out bearings prematurely. After installation, run the fan at high speed and check for wobble. Use a balancing kit—typically included with quality fans—to add small weights to blades until rotation is smooth. Clean blades monthly; dust buildup adds weight and disrupts aerodynamics. Tighten all screws seasonally, as vibration can loosen them over time. Lubricate the motor if your model has oil ports (many modern sealed motors don’t require this). These simple maintenance steps preserve peak efficiency and prevent costly repairs.
Operating Tips to Slash Energy Bills
Seasonal Direction Settings Explained
That little switch on your fan isn’t decorative—it’s a game-changer for efficiency. In summer, run the fan counterclockwise to push cool air down directly on occupants, creating a wind-chill effect that makes rooms feel 4-8 degrees cooler. This allows you to raise your thermostat by several degrees. In winter, flip the switch to clockwise rotation at low speed. This gentle updraft recirculates warm air that pools near the ceiling, distributing it evenly throughout the room. This simple seasonal adjustment can reduce heating and cooling costs by 15% annually when used consistently.
Optimal Speed Settings for Comfort
Running your fan on high speed constantly wastes energy and creates unnecessary noise. Most comfort needs are met at medium or low speeds. Start at medium and adjust based on occupancy and activity level—sedentary activities need less airflow than cooking or exercising. Use programmable timers to run fans only when rooms are occupied. In bedrooms, consider fans with more speed options; having 6 speeds instead of 3 allows you to find the perfect low setting for sleeping without overcooling. Remember, fans cool people, not rooms, so turn them off when you leave to maximize savings.
Integrating with HVAC Systems
Ceiling fans and air conditioning work best as a team. Set your thermostat 4 degrees higher than usual and run ceiling fans in occupied rooms. The wind-chill effect makes the space feel just as comfortable while reducing AC runtime by up to 30%. Ensure your HVAC vents aren’t blocked by fan airflow—position fans to complement, not compete with, your ventilation system. In homes with zone cooling, use fans to extend conditioned air into peripheral spaces, allowing you to set those zones higher or off entirely. This synergy between systems is where the real energy savings materialize.
Advanced Technologies Worth Considering
DC Motors vs. AC Motors
The motor debate centers on efficiency versus cost. DC motors use 70% less energy than comparable AC motors and offer nearly silent operation with more speed settings (often 6-7 vs. 3-4). They generate minimal heat, reducing cooling load in summer. However, they cost more upfront—typically $50-150 more than AC equivalents. AC motors have improved significantly and remain reliable and cost-effective for budget-conscious buyers. For rooms used more than 8 hours daily, DC motors pay for themselves within 2-3 years through energy savings. For guest rooms or rarely used spaces, quality AC motors offer perfectly adequate efficiency.
Energy Star Certification Deep Dive
Energy Star certification guarantees minimum efficiency standards, but the range within certified models is vast. To earn the label, fans must exceed baseline efficiency by at least 20% and include features like adjustable speed and at least a 30-year motor warranty. However, some Energy Star fans achieve 300+ CFM per watt, while others barely clear the 75 CFM per watt minimum. Always check the actual efficiency rating on the Energy Star product list rather than assuming all certified models perform equally. The certification is a starting point, not the finish line, for efficiency shopping.
Integrated Lighting Efficiency
Many modern fans include LED lighting kits, but not all LEDs are equally efficient. Look for integrated LEDs rated at least 90 CRI (color rendering index) for quality light, and check the lumens-per-watt rating—quality fixtures deliver 100+ lumens per watt. Avoid fans that use screw-in bulbs unless they’re specifically designed for high-efficiency LEDs; traditional sockets tempt users to install inefficient incandescent bulbs. The best integrated lighting uses warm-dimming technology that adjusts color temperature as it dims, maintaining ambiance while saving energy. Some models even offer separate circuits, allowing you to run the fan without lights for maximum efficiency.
Budget Considerations and Long-Term Savings
Upfront Costs vs. Lifetime Value
A premium efficient fan might cost $300-600 versus $100-150 for a basic model, but the math favors quality. Assuming 8 hours daily use at $0.13 per kWh, a DC motor fan saves about $25 annually in electricity compared to an efficient AC model, and $75+ versus an older inefficient fan. Over a 15-year lifespan, that’s $375-1,125 in savings. Add reduced HVAC wear and potential rebates, and premium fans often pay for themselves. Cheap fans may also need replacement in 3-5 years, while quality models last 20+ years. Consider the total cost of ownership, not just the purchase price.
Rebates and Incentive Programs
Many utilities offer rebates for Energy Star certified ceiling fans, typically $15-50 per fan. Some programs provide additional incentives for DC motor models or smart-enabled fans. Check your utility company’s website or the Database of State Incentives for Renewables & Efficiency (DSIRE). These programs exist because utilities recognize that efficient fans reduce peak grid demand during hot summer afternoons. The application process is usually simple—submit a receipt and product information online. Some retailers even automate the rebate process at checkout. These incentives can slash 10-30% off your purchase price, accelerating the payback period.
Warranty Coverage That Matters
A robust warranty signals manufacturer confidence and protects your investment. Look for lifetime warranties on the motor and at least 5 years on components. Read the fine print—some “lifetime” warranties are prorated, reducing coverage value over time. The best warranties include in-home service, saving you the hassle of removal and shipping for repairs. A 30-year motor warranty is standard for premium efficient fans and suggests the motor is built to last. Avoid fans with only 1-2 year warranties; they indicate lower quality components that may fail just outside the coverage period, negating any initial savings.
Frequently Asked Questions
How much electricity does an energy efficient ceiling fan actually save compared to air conditioning?
An efficient ceiling fan uses 15-30 watts on high speed, while central AC consumes 2,000-5,000 watts. Using fans allows you to raise your thermostat by 4 degrees, reducing AC runtime by up to 30%. This translates to roughly $0.50-1.50 per day in summer savings for a typical home, or $90-270 over a three-month cooling season.
Can I install an energy efficient fan on a sloped or vaulted ceiling?
Yes, but you’ll need an angled mounting kit and potentially a longer downrod. The fan must hang vertically regardless of ceiling angle. Most manufacturers offer sloped ceiling adapters for pitches up to 30 degrees. For steeper angles, you may need a custom solution. The key is maintaining the 8-9 foot blade height above the floor for optimal performance.
Do more blades make a ceiling fan more efficient?
No, blade count has minimal impact on efficiency. Three to five well-designed blades typically outperform more numerous poorly designed ones. Blade aerodynamics, pitch angle, and motor power are far more important than quantity. Some efficient commercial fans use only two blades, while many decorative models with six or seven blades move air less effectively.
What’s the difference between damp-rated and wet-rated fans?
Damp-rated fans withstand moisture and humidity in covered outdoor areas like porches but can’t handle direct water exposure. Wet-rated fans have sealed motors and weatherproof housings that survive rain, snow, and direct splashing. Using a damp-rated fan in a wet location voids warranties and creates safety hazards. Always match the rating to your specific installation environment.
How do I know if my ceiling fan is properly balanced?
Turn the fan to high speed and observe from below. If you see wobbling or hear rhythmic clicking, it’s unbalanced. You can also place a stationary object near one blade and slowly rotate the fan by hand—each blade should pass at the same distance. Most fans include a balancing kit with adhesive weights you can attach to blades until wobble disappears.
Should ceiling fans run clockwise or counterclockwise in summer?
Counterclockwise for summer cooling. This direction pushes air straight down, creating a direct breeze and wind-chill effect on your skin. The switch is typically located on the motor housing above the blades. When standing under the fan, you should feel a distinct downward airflow, not a gentle updraft.
How long do energy efficient ceiling fans typically last?
Quality DC motor fans last 20-25 years with minimal maintenance. AC motor fans typically last 10-15 years. The difference comes from reduced heat and friction in DC motors. Regular cleaning and proper installation significantly impact lifespan. Fans in clean, indoor environments last longer than those in dusty or humid conditions.
Can smart ceiling fans really save more energy than standard efficient models?
Yes, through automation and behavior change. Smart fans with occupancy sensors eliminate forgotten operation, while scheduling features align runtime with actual occupancy. Integration with thermostats optimizes whole-home efficiency. Studies show smart controls can reduce fan energy use by an additional 15-25% beyond the base motor efficiency.
What’s the ideal ceiling height for maximum fan efficiency?
Blades should be 8-9 feet above the floor. This height creates the widest air circulation pattern, reaching walls and corners effectively. Too low and airflow is concentrated in a narrow column; too high and the air movement dissipates before reaching occupants. Use downrods to achieve this height on tall ceilings, and choose flush-mount fans for standard 8-foot ceilings.
Are ceiling fans effective in winter for heating efficiency?
Absolutely. Running fans clockwise at low speed in winter recirculates warm air trapped near the ceiling, potentially lowering heating costs by 10-15%. This is especially valuable in rooms with high ceilings or poor air circulation. The key is low speed—high speed would create a cooling draft that counteracts heating efforts.
